Simplifying individual payments is a crucial element for any successful healthcare practice. Adopting streamlined payment processes can greatly decrease administrative burden, enhance patient satisfaction, and ultimately bolster your practice's financial stability.
A few key strategies can aid you in achieving this goal. Firstly, consider providing a variety of payment choices, including online systems, mobile transfers, and established methods like debit cards and insurance. Secondly, deploy distinct billing practices that are understandable for patients to comprehend. Regularly communicating with clients about their payment responsibilities can also avoid payment delays and issues.
Lastly, allocating in patient-centric technology solutions can optimize many aspects of the payment process.
This can include systems for online appointment scheduling, digital alerts, and encrypted transaction gateways.
Regularly reviewing your payment processes and making modifications as needed is essential to ensure their productivity.

Empowering Patients with Flexible Payment Options
In today's healthcare landscape, financial concerns can often be a barrier to receiving necessary care. To address this critical issue, many healthcare providers are now offering diverse flexible payment solutions. These options aim to make treatment more accessible for patients by providing them with greater control over their payments. Often offered solutions include:
- Payment plans
- Financing options
- Sliding scale fees
By adopting these flexible payment strategies, healthcare providers can reduce financial obstacles and ensure that patients have the means to prioritize their health. This ultimately contributes to a more equitable and patient-centered healthcare system.
